CLDR region code of the country/region of the address. This is
used to address ambiguity of the user-input location, for
example, "Liverpool" against "Liverpool, NY, US" or
"Liverpool, UK". Set this field to bias location resolution
toward a specific country or territory. If this field is not
set, application behavior is biased toward the United States
by default. See http://cldr.unicode.org/ and http://www.unico
de.org/cldr/charts/30/supplemental/territory_information.html
for details. Example: "CH" for Switzerland. Note that this
filter is not applicable for Profile Search related queries.
The distance_in_miles is applied when the location being
searched for is identified as a city or smaller. This field is
ignored if the location being searched for is a state or
larger.
